Output cffdbbd03819ef1e4ab89836bbfa26c3721ce01bd0fb3ab7d558600a40d26e66:0

value
29408940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c9ad935525301db59536a7aa8e2a7f406efd86 OP_EQUAL
address
3KzgfkAN8SsCFS6882YCcfKe5ymkQdXafn
transaction
cffdbbd03819ef1e4ab89836bbfa26c3721ce01bd0fb3ab7d558600a40d26e66
confirmations
216062
spent
true